Answer:
9x^2+42x+45
Step-by-step explanation:
Foil (3x+5)(3x+9) by taking the numbers in the left parenthesis and multiplying it by the numbers on the right. So 3x(3x), then 3x(9), then 5(3x) and 5(9). Now we have 9x^2 + 27x+15x+45, simplify to get 9x^2+42x+45.

Step-by-step explanation:
Angle at Center = 2 * Angle at Circumference
Therefore B = 2A.
When B = 100°, A = 100°/2 = 50° (B),
When A = 48°, B = 2(48°) = 96°. (C)
